usually adsl providers will have a 50:1 contention ratio.
You'll have a adsl line, at any one time upto 50 users could be using that same line.

512kb/s shared between 50 users.

but in practice not many people will be sharing that line around ur area.
depends on the area tbh

don't get a usb modem,
get a PCI modem,
u can either get a PCI adsl modem , or PCI network card.

they will do the same job, just configure it up, (instructions should be availble on the ISP site)

you'll need a splitter (microfilter )for the adt box.

look around, u could pick up pci modems for 20£.
